X-ray Imaging of Transplanar Liquid Transport Mechanisms in Single Layer Textiles
Understanding the
penetration of liquids within textile fibers
is critical for the development of next-generation smart textiles.
Despite substantial research on liquid penetration in the plane of
the textile, little is known about how the liquid penetrates in the
thickness direction. Here we report a time-resolved high-resolution
X-ray measurement of the motion of the liquidâair interface
within a single layer textile, as the liquid is transported across
the textile thickness following the deposition of a droplet. The measurement
of the time-dependent position of the liquid meniscus is made possible
by the use of ultrahigh viscosity liquids (dynamic viscosity from
10<sup>5</sup> to 2.5 Ă 10<sup>6</sup>Â times larger than
water). This approach enables imaging due to the slow penetration
kinetics. Imaging results suggest a three-stage penetration process
with each stage being associated with one of the three types of capillary
channels existing in the textile geometry, providing insights into
the effect of the textile structure on the path of the three-dimensional
liquid meniscus. One dimensional kinetics studies show that our data
for the transplanar penetration depth Î<i>x</i><sub>L</sub> vs time do not conform to a power law, and that the measured
rate of penetration for long times is smaller than that predicted
by LucasâWashburn kinetics, challenging commonly held assumptions
regarding the validity of power laws when applied to relatively thin
textiles

Boosting the Performance of PC-based Software Routers with FPGA-enhanced Network Interface Cards
The research community is devoting increasing attention to software routers based on off-the-shelf hardware and open-source operating systems running on the personalcomputer (PC) architecture. Today's high-end PCs are equipped with peripheral component interconnect (PCI) shared buses enabling them to easily fit into the multi-gigabit-per-second routing segment, for a price much lower than that of commercial routers. However, commercially-available PC network interface cards (NICs) lack programmability, and require not only packets to cross the PCI bus twice, but also to be processed in software by the operating system, strongly reducing the achievable forwarding rate. It is therefore interesting to explore the performance of customizable NICs based on field-programmable gate array (FPGA) logic devices we developed and assess how well they can overcome the limitations of today's commercially-available NIC
Sporadic flat ileal adenocarcinoma: an intriguing challenge in the comprehension of a rare neoplasia and its genesis. Case report and review of literature
Small bowel adenocarcinoma is a rare tumor, with a still not well studied tumorigenesis process, usually presenting in an advanced stage. The clinical diagnosis is often difficult; surgery is the treatment of choice when feasible, while the chemotherapic approach is still not well codified. We describe the case of a 71-yr-old male patient, presenting with an acute right abdomen. At laparotomy the terminal ileum appeared chronically inflamed and thickened. An ileocecal resection with laterolateral
ileocolic anastomosis was performed. The gross appearance resembled an inflammatory bowel disease, but microscopic examination revealed the extensive presence of an infiltrating ileal adenocarcinoma. Literature about small bowel adenocarcinoma has been reviewed for better understanding its pathogenesis
A multi-purpose control and power electronic architecture for active magnetic actuators
This paper shows the results related with the
design and implementation of a multi-purpose electronic
architecture used to drive magnetic actuators by means of a
three-phase independent-legs module in place of the
commonly used H-bridge modules. The typical application
is the magnetic actuators drive used in active magnetic
bearings. The architecture is composed of a control unit
with a floating point Digital Signal Processor (DSP), a
power board with six independent phase legs and a carrier
board to interconnect them. When more than one module is
required by the application, the communication between
them is guaranteed by means of CAN bus interconnection.
The proposed system allows to drive two pairs of opposite
electromagnets, such as those typically used to control active
magnetic bearings. The study is motivated by the
opportunity of reducing the amount of power and control
electronic components resulting in a more straightforward,
efficient and cost reduction design

Fault management in an i.c. engine piezoelectric fuel injection system
A piezoelectric injection system 15, eg for a diesel engine, comprises a VDCpower supply 24 for supplying a power circuit 17 provided with a DC-DC converter having high-side and low-side drivers 20, 21 connected at a switching node 22, the drivers being electrically connected to at least a piezoelectric injector 16. The value of an electric parameter representative of the operation the injection system is monitored and compared with a predetermined reference parameter value, and emergency means 32 are activated when the monitored parameter value exceeds the respective reference value. The electric parameter may be the current flowing through the piezoelectric actuator 19 and/or the low-side driver 21, sensed by current sensor 30, or the voltage across the piezoelectric actuator. The emergency means 32 may interrupt the operation of the drivers 20, 21, discharge the piezoelectric injector or disconnect the injector form the power circuit 1
Model and Design of a Power Driver for Piezoelectric Stack Actuators
A power driver has been developed to control piezoelectric stack actuators used in automotive application. An FEM model of the actuator has been implemented starting from experimental characterization of the stack and mechanical and piezoelectric parameters. Experimental results are reported to show a correct piezoelectric actuator driving method and the possibility to obtain a sensorless positioning control
